Introduction to Complementary and Supplementary Angles
Complementary Angles: Complementary angles add up to 90 degrees. This means that if one angle is known, the measure of the other angle can be found by subtracting the known angle from 90 degrees. Supplementary Angles: Supplementary angles add up to 180 degrees. Let's consider an example where angle A is 120 degrees and determine if angle A can be complementary or supplementary to angle B.
1. Complementary Angles
For two angles to be complementary, their sum must be 90 degrees. If angle A is 120 degrees, it is impossible for angle A to be complementary to another angle. This is because 120 degrees is already greater than 90 degrees. Therefore, angle A cannot be complementary to any angle B. 2. Supplementary Angles
If angle A is 120 degrees, the complementary approach does not apply. Instead, let's consider supplementary angles. To find angle B, which would be supplementary to angle A, we subtract the measure of angle A from 180 degrees:
[B 180 - 120][B 60 text{ degrees}]Therefore, angle B would be 60 degrees in the case of supplementary angles.
